Save money on your central heating

Considering the weather conditions we have, it is almost a basic necessity to have central heating in place. However, this too can suck up on power and can give you a power bill that is heart-attack inducing at the end of the month. If you are one of the families that has central heating in Preston, then here are some tips to help you lower your expenses for heating.

Now heating is used largely in winters, but fact is that the system is just like any other piece of machinery and needs to be run on a regular basis. Even during the summer months it would be a good idea to run the heating for a while. This will allow the boiler to work property and prevent the circulating pump from jamming up.

Before you begin to use the heating system on a regular basis it would be a good idea to get it serviced. This would essential mean once or twice a year. You could also take out some insurance or service plans which discount servicing prices and the replacing of certain parts. Make it a point to regularly bleed your radiators and make sure that you don’t have any air pockets in them. This can significantly bring down the efficacy of your heating and cost you more in the long run.

Keep your radiators well ventilated and don’t block them with any cupboards or sofas. This will bring down their efficiency since you end up cranking up the thermostat to get the most out of it. This forces the system to work much harder than it should. It would also be a good idea to have some safety measures in place. A carbon-monoxide alarm would be a good one to have. This will set off if there is a leakage in your system. If you find the smell of gas in the air, then ventilate the place, get out and call emergency services. Most boilers have got a pilot light. Keep an eye on it. If it is blue in color, then the boiler is working as it
should, if it flickers or is yellow-orange shade you may need an expert to look at it.

Having an insurance plan in place for your heating system is a good idea. You will especially need this should your system require replacement in peak seasons. Good maintenance will ensure however that things don’t come to that level.

How to save money on heating

Heating our homes has never been so expensive and our bills look set to rise this year yet again.  If you are worried about the next lot of energy hikes you might now be thinking about how you can save money.  There are ways in which you can save money and this article will explain exactly what you can do.

Energy Supply
First up you need to see if you are on the cheapest tariff for your energy.  You can look on comparison sites to see if you can save money.  Always make sure you pay your bills by direct debit as you will save a good 5-10%.  The reason you get these savings is that when you pay a fixed monthly amount you will possible be over paying and energy companies can make interest of these overpayments.  At the end of the year you will get any overpayments back.  Also having your bills emailed to you rather than posting gives you more savings, plus it saves trees which is always good.

Home Insulation
Insulating your home, especially your walls and loft, will make a dramatic difference to your bills.  Your attack should have 10 inches of insulation according to building regulations.  When we have heavy snow you can always tell which homes are insulated properly by the snow on the roof.  If the roof doesn’t have enough insulation the snow on your roof will melt.  This is caused by the heat from your heating system escaping.  If you have the right amount of insulation the heat will not escape and not melt the snow.  Next time you have a lot of snow have a look one evening (when most people are home and heating will be turned on) at the roofs of all the houses on your street, you will see which ones have good insulation. 

Boilers
If your boiler is over 10 years old you are effectively throwing half of your energy away.  Old boilers waste a lot of energy through the flue, whereas modern condensing boilers have a second heat exchanger which captures the steam and turns that back into reusable energy. Also if you have an old system boiler with a water cylinder but you only have one bathroom in your home, your boiler is having to work harder to heat all this water.  Modern combi boilers heat water on demand when a tap is turned on and don’t need to heat a whole water tank.  Also having proper controls on your boiler system allows you to control the temperature of your rooms.  Having thermostatic valves and a room thermostat is what is needed to control the temperature correctly.

Use of boiler
If you don’t turn your boiler on the minute autumn arrives you will save money.  Try just adding a few layers of clothing instead and hold off turning your heating on until November.  When you do put your heating on turn it down just a bit as this is another way of saving you money.
By following all of the above you will make substantial savings on your heating bills which could be better spent elsewhere.  There are other options like renewable heat energy such as installing solar panels or air source heat pumps, but he outlay for this is quite substantial.
